Traci Bransford Honored with Reatha Clark King Award by VocalEssence
Stinson LLP is excited to announce that Partner Traci Bransford is being recognized with the Reatha Clark King Award for Excellence and Youth Motivation through the Cultural Arts by VocalEssence.
Named after VocalEssence WITNESS co-founder and pioneering African American scientist, educator and philanthropist Reatha Clark King, the award recognizes outstanding leaders in the entertainment field who are empowering young people through enticing choral music programing such as concerts, learning and engagement programs, contests and recording. Honorees are presented with an original work of art by local artist Ta-Coumba Aiken as a memento of the award at the annual VocalEssence WITNESS concert. Bransford was formerly on the Board of Directors for VocalEssence, Co-chair of the WITNESS Advisory Council and served as Vice President during her final term.
Bransford serves as Co-chair of Stinson's Entertainment and Media law group with decades of experience leading negotiations for entertainment and media transactions for music, television, film and literary matters. Traci also serves as general counsel to collegiate, professional and retired athletes in their individual business and philanthropic pursuits.
Locally, Bransford is a member of the Minnesota Association of Black Lawyers (MABL), Minnesota State Bar Association and the Hennepin County Bar Association. Nationally, she is also an active member of the National Bar Association, Black Entertainment & Sports Lawyers Association (BESLA), Sports Lawyers Association (SLA) and participates in programming of the Minority Corporate Counsel Association (MCCA). She is also a member of the Thomson Reuters Institute Diversity Equity and Inclusion Advisory Board and serves on the Board of Directors of Planned Parenthood of North Central States. Bransford was named a 2020 "Notable Women in Law" by the Twin Cities Business Magazine and was recognized by Chambers for the 2020 Diversity & Inclusion Award Short List - "Diversity & Inclusion Lawyer of the Year". Bransford is consistently recognized by the Minnesota State Bar for her Pro Bono service to the legal profession. Bransford frequently speaks at colleges and universities, continuing legal education seminars, entertainment and sports-related events in the Twin Cities and across the country.
